Definitions

  1. n. A professional poet and singer, as among the ancient Celts, whose occupation was to compose and sing verses in honor of the heroic achievements of princes and brave men.
  2. n. Hence: A poet; as, the bard of Avon.
  3. n. Alt. of Barde
  4. v. t. To cover (meat or game) with a thin slice of fat bacon.
